Ok- I think I've found the source of all our frustrations with NZWP- Originally I started creating it in it's own folder as I thought it would be a separate release. Part way through I decided to include it in the Airfields pack and so moved it into that development folder- When I built the installer I used the incorrect facilities files which means I wasn't seeing the problems others were seeing.

So- attached to this post are replacement files [attachment=585:NZWP_ADEX_VLC.zip]
Just replace the files of the same name in your VLC_Airfields/Scenery folder (i.e. C:\Program Files (x86)\Microsoft Games\Microsoft Flight Simulator X\VLC_Airfields\Scenery)

These will be included in the next Nth Island airport pack release too.

hmm good point- ZKCAV- what priority is your VLC_Airfields folder? If other scenery is using an exclude, then this could be excluding my flatten which would cause the issues you have.
